With our latest big content update (v1.3.0) came a few bugs.

Here's what we have fixed:

FPS Drops and Map Falling

There was a bug in an "update" loop which meant it sent logs at the framerate specified per account (ie. 60 times a second if framerate was set at 60fps).

This slows down the computer and puts a ton of load on our remote logging service.

Cris has found a quick fix for this, and we'll be finding time to find the proper and perfect fix very soon!

Faulty Items

We fixed almost immediately after this was discovered because we're just the best devs, but this was a problem where dropped Shield Cells and Bulletproof Vests would recharge with full armor.

This was not intended, and has been fixed.

With this quick patch, Enemy On Board should be back to the game you know and love! See you onboard.
